MapAutomationPeer.GetClassNameCore Method

[ This article is for Windows Phone 8 developers. If you’re developing for Windows 10, see the latest documentation. ]

Retrieves the name that is used with AutomationControlType to differentiate the control that is represented by this automation peer. Called by GetClassName().

Namespace:  Microsoft.Phone.Automation.Peers
Assembly:  Microsoft.Phone.Maps (in Microsoft.Phone.Maps.dll)

protected override string GetClassNameCore()

Return Value

Type: System.String
Returns String.
